The City of Winder Fire Department is seeking a highly skilled, detail‑driven Executive Assistant to provide specialized administrative support to the Fire Chief and department leadership. This role is ideal for a seasoned professional who thrives in a fast‑paced, service‑oriented environment and can balance confidentiality, accuracy, and initiative with ease.

Position Overview

The Executive Assistant performs a wide range of administrative, clerical, and programmatic duties that support daily operations of the Fire Department. This includes managing sensitive information, coordinating schedules, preparing departmental documents, maintaining records, supporting budget processes, and serving as a key point of contact for internal staff and the public.

Key Responsibilities
  • Administrative Support — Maintain departmental records, prepare correspondence, manage mail, and support daily office operations.
  • Executive Coordination — Manage calendars, appointments, deadlines, and travel arrangements for the Fire Chief.
  • Confidential Records — Handle sensitive personnel files, payroll data, attendance records, and other confidential materials.
  • Budget & Finance — Review and code expenses, monitor budget balances, compile financial data, and assist with annual budget preparation.
  • Public Interaction — Greet visitors, respond to inquiries, and support public noticing and posting requirements.
  • Department Liaison — Serve as a communication bridge between the Fire Department, Human Resources, and other City departments.
  • Operational Support — Assist with departmental goals, review documentation for accuracy, support purchasing processes, and ensure compliance with City policies.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
